Two specific things I don't like about the new map

People who played TT: Hate new map
People who didn't play TT: Love the new map
Solution: Make two separate maps!
I've been saying that since I heard they were making these changes. It makes me sad every time I play this new map, there is no laning and scarcely any true strategy/timing of attacks. The new look is good but that's about the only redeeming factor I see here...